Noor Ahmad joined the big event after his impressive performance at the Asian Cup in the United Arab Emirates (UAE). In three matches, the left arm wrist spinner picked up eight wickets with more than a decent economy. Before that, Ahmed also played for the Galle Gladiators in the Lanka Premier League (LPL) in 2022.
